Output d1bc953deb700306f004404d89c531c73a476992675a4dfa78484c8bd34312de:1

value
143478544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e820dac4708c755420215649fdb67647ee594762 OP_EQUALVERIFY OP_CHECKSIG
address
1NAP8HDF24TGEcZ2AL3c97EpSqhWLzkeH5
transaction
d1bc953deb700306f004404d89c531c73a476992675a4dfa78484c8bd34312de
spent
true